Description:
(Description blatantly stolen from Husk's first cup :))

LG Flyshopper: The fly is so long you need to use Low Gravity to fly it, feel free to activate/deactivate low gravity anytime you want (= no need to keep low gravity active just to make ur roping slower.

about the scheme: This scheme is TUS shopper (made by Wooka) + infinite low gravity, so all the weapons chances from crates in tus shopper are same here.

groups best of 1
knockouts and finals best of 3

1 month deadline for group stage and 2 weeks for each round of knockout stage. If the cup already started but you can't play for some reason, post it here, please.
If you can't find your opponent, send him/her a PM or post in the cup forum (preferrably both) and state a day and time for the two of you to play.

example replay of LG Flyshopper match can be found from scheme page
